In case you didn't know GC2018 aims to attract the best athletes to compete in a technically excellent, world class, fun and friendly Commonwealth Games.
The Gold Coast 2018 Commonwealth Games (GC2018) will be the largest sporting event Australia will see this decade and the biggest sporting spectacular the Gold Coast has ever seen. As the first regional Australian city to ever host a Commonwealth Games, the Gold Coast will celebrate a great Games in a great city leaving great memories and great benefits for all. The city will shine on the world sporting stage and the promotional exposure for business, trade, investment, tourism and events will herald a new era in the region’s growth and maturity. The GC2018 brand embraces the three pillars of - The Place, The Event and The Sport.
On 4 April 2018, over 6,600 athletes and team officials from 70 nations and territories will converge on the Gold Coast for an 11 day sporting and cultural event.
The event is unprecedented in our city’s history, and is destined to define our future.
With the proud support of close to 15,000 passionate and friendly volunteers, a spectacle of 18 sports and 7 para-sports will be contested and broadcast to a cumulative global audience of 1.5 billion.

Join me as I try out some advanced skincare treatments for the first time, featuring both microdermabrasion and Low-level light therapy.
In case you don’t know, microdermabrasion is a non-invasive treatment that gently exfoliates to smooth, brighten, and rejuvenate skin.
It achieves this by using a device which removes the outer layer of dead skin cells.
Low-level light therapy provides therapeutic use of light to the surface of the skin to help cellular function, reduce active acne and promote skin rejuvenation.
With these treatments there is no downtime and typically 4-6 treatments are recommended for best results.
It’s also a great complementary treatment to injectables.

In today’s episode I breakdown a common skin infection - Genital Herpes.
Genital herpes is caused by the virus known as Herpes Simplex Virus (HSV), of which there are two types, 1 and 2. HSV is a common Sexually Transmitted Infection, affecting up to 1 in 8 Australians over the age of 25.
Typically HSV 1 tends to affect the mouth area causing cold sores, and HSV 2 favours the genitalia. However due to changes in sexual practice, the two can be reversed.
The first episode of HSV 2 can be proceeded by a prodrome of feeling unwell, having fevers, chills, glandular swelling and general fatigue. Thereafter there may be some blisters and ulceration which can be sore, itchy and painful.
Usually patients will present to the doctor for treatment. This will usually encompass an examination, including a swab and medication which can take the form of an anaesthetic cream or anti-viral tablets. These will help to reduce the symptom duration. Usually the first episode will last up to 3 weeks.
HSV is transmitted through close skin to skin contact and so it is vital if you are affected not to engage in this practice until symptoms have resolved on the advice of your doctor. Transmission can also occur in asymptomatic people and so the best way to help prevent infection is to use barrier methods.
HSV remains dormant in the body after initial infection and can reoccur especially if your immune system is low or you are stressed. Typically recurrent episodes tend to be less severe and shorter in duration.
It is therefore important to lead an active and healthy lifestyle to reduce your chances of getting a recurrent outbreak.

Join me as I bake a healthier low calorie version of the classic Carrot Cake. A popular choice by many in the belief the carrots make it a healthier option, it is often laden with sugar, oil and butter.
In this episode, I share with you healthier alternatives to common ingredients to create this masterpiece whilst maintaining a genuine taste.
RECIPE AND METHOD
For the mixture:
- 3 Eggs
- 3 Grated Carrots
- 1 Tsp Fresh ginger
- 5 Dates cut in quarters
- 220g Pineapple mashed, without the juice
- 20g Walnuts
- 50ml Sugar-Free Maple syrup
- 1 Cup Flour
- 1 Tsp Bicarbonate of soda
- 2 Tsp Baking powder
- 2 Tsp Cinnamon powder
Mix the dry ingredients together and set aside. In a separate bowl mix the carrots, eggs, ginger, walnuts, dates, pineapple and maple syrup together. Once you have achieved an even texture add in the dry ingredients. Be sure not to over beat the mixture as the cake will loose its height.
Transfer the mixture into a baking tin and place in an already heated oven at 180 degrees for 30-40 minutes or until a knife can come out clean from the cake.
Set aside to rest and enjoy with a lovely cup of tea.
Please remember to always eat treats sensibly as part of a full healthy balanced diet and an active lifestyle.
